Problems solved by technology

However, in the case of using the former method, if the user changes the mobile phone card (or mobile phone number) on the same device, the user must manually modify his configured mobile phone number again, otherwise the call center system will fail. Unable to send "destination" to the user terminal smoothly
At the same time, when using the former method, if the user does not read the instructions carefully or has a deep understanding of the system, the user cannot operate the system by himself.
In addition, if you choose to use the latter method of asking the user's phone number through the call center service personnel during the call, although the "destination" can be successfully sent to the corresponding user terminal, the operation process is relatively cumbersome
[0004] To sum up, the problem that needs to be solved urgently is that when using the above two methods to obtain the mobile phone number of the user terminal, either the "destination" cannot be guaranteed to be sent to the user terminal smoothly, or the operation process is too cumbersome. The invention discloses a method for automatically obtaining equipment information in a Telematics system during using navigation with one key. According to the method, a call center system can automatically and accurately obtain a cell-phone number of a user terminal and an IMSI corresponding to the cell-phone number by establishing the interaction between the user terminal and servers of telecom operators or the like, and even if a user changes a mobile telephone card on an identical user terminal, the call center system can also automatically and accurately judge and obtains the cell-phone number of the user terminal again, so that compared with a system providing similar service, the technical scheme has the advantages that independently inputting relevant information by a user (or informing the information through a cell phone) is changed into automatically identifying, judging and obtaining the information through the system, the operation flow of the user is greatly simplified, the method is suitable for users in various levels, the users are not required to learn the method, and the complex steps are automatically accomplished, which are required to be accomplished through manual operation.

Technical field [0001] The present invention relates to a method for automatically acquiring equipment information when using "one-key navigation", in particular to a method for automatically acquiring equipment information through a network when using "one-key navigation" in a Telematics system. Background technique [0002] This technical solution belongs to the supporting application of the one-key navigation system in the technical field of Telematics (that is, the vehicle-mounted computer system using wireless communication technology), and involves the use of mobile communication networks (2G, 3G, 4G) to automatically obtain the mobile phone number of the user terminal through the network Technical solutions. [0003] In the application of the Telematics system, the application of dispatching the desired destination to the user through the call center on manual and performing autonomous navigation planning on the application terminal has become very popular.
